An IT Development Manager is responsible for overseeing the development and implementation of software projects within an organization. They lead a team of developers, ensuring that projects are delivered on time, within budget, and meet the required quality standards. The IT Development Manager works closely with stakeholders to understand their requirements and translate them into technical specifications. They provide guidance and support to the development team, ensuring that they have the necessary resources and tools to complete their tasks effectively. Additionally, they monitor project progress, identify and mitigate risks, and make necessary adjustments to ensure successful project delivery. This role requires strong leadership and communication skills, as well as a deep understanding of software development methodologies and technologies.

It Development Manager salary in Mexico
Average Yearly Salary of It Development Manager in Mexico is approximately 945,507 MXN (47,249 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Estimated national average yearly salary is 331,152 MXN (18,410 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ated It Development Manager job salary compared to average salary in Mexico.
Comparison shows that a person working as It Development Manager in Mexico earns on average:
2.86 times the average salary (or 286% of average salary).
